Corpse Reviver

Created by: Howcan Team

Ingredients

  • 3/4 oz gin
  • 3/4 oz Cointreau
  • 3/4 oz Lillet Blanc
  • 3/4 oz fresh lemon juice
  • 1 dash absinthe
  • 1 cherry (for garnish)

Instructions

  • Fill a shaker with ice.
  • Add 3/4 oz gin, 3/4 oz Cointreau, 3/4 oz Lillet Blanc, and 3/4 oz fresh lemon juice to the shaker.
  • Add a dash of absinthe to the shaker.
  • Shake well until chilled.
  • Strain the mixture into a chilled cocktail glass.
  • Garnish with a cherry.
  • Serve and enjoy!

The Corpse Reviver is a classic cocktail with a storied history. Believed to have originated in the 19th century, this revitalizing libation was designed to cure hangovers and revive the spirits. The most famous variation, Corpse Reviver No. 2, gained popularity during the Prohibition era and has since become a staple in mixology. This cocktail typically consists of gin, Cointreau, Lillet Blanc, lemon juice, and a dash of absinthe, creating a refreshing and zesty flavor profile. While the exact origins of the Corpse Reviver are debated, its enduring appeal has solidified its place in cocktail culture. Today, top mixologists and bars around the world continue to craft their own unique interpretations of this timeless drink.
